How to Autorun the JMP Script every 1 hour.

I have jmp script. I would like it to run every 1 hours to see trends. Please let me know if it is possible.

Re: How to Autorun the JMP Script every 1 hour.

You can either use an operating system scheduler program which will run a JMP pgm, or you can startup a JMP session and run a JMP script that uses the Schedule() function.
